I bought a used 555 from Ten-Tec early last year and found the tuning to be 
stiff indeed, even for a PTO design.  Bravely (foolishly?), I took the thing 
completely apart (this took some doing) and found that the PTO was spring 
loaded, with three small plastic spacers to give the spring extra compression.  
I took out two of the spacers and reassembled the rig, only to be greeted with 
no audio output because I had forgotten to plug one of the cables back in (and 
I had to take the rig mostly apart again to get to it).  I was mostly satisifed 
with the resulting tuning tension.  
Some months later at a hamfest, I picked up a mil surplus knob that was a 
*perfect* fit for the Scout and has a finger indent, further aiding tuning 
ease.  I found it was hard to locate a small enough knob with an indent, but 
they are out there.
